Any speculation about Spirit Airlines filing for bankruptcy in the wake of the blocked merger with JetBlue Airways is definitely premature.
Not when you plan to launch new routes. Nine of them, in fact, for this summer.
That doesn’t sound like an airline flirting with bankruptcy.
The low-cost carrier will introduce nine nonstop services out of Boston; Portland, Oregon; Columbus, Ohio; and Salt Lake City. Also, on May 8, the airline will begin flying between Portland and Chicago six times a week to become the first budget airline to service that route.
The other new routes will be offered once daily. They are:
The flight from Salt Lake City to Fort Lauderdale is fortuitous, as it will start as soon as JetBlue puts a cease to that route.
Travelers will also be able to fly to San Juan from Houston and New Orleans, along with a list of new domestic flights beginning in May and June.
